How much do virtual admin j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 9, 2026, the average hourly pay for virtual admin in Indiana is $23.22,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$19.42 and $26.06 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ges Virtual Admins face when supporting multiple clients remotely?

Virtual Admins often juggle tasks for several clients, which can make prioritizing and managing time a challenge. Clear communication and setting expectations are essential to avoid misunderstandings and ensure deadlines are met. Additionally, adapting quickly to different tools, workflows, and preferences across clients is crucial for efficiency. Building strong organizational habits and leveraging productivity software can help Virtual Admins stay on top of diverse responsibilities.

What are Virtual Admins?

Virtual Admins, also known as Virtual Administrative Assistants, are professionals who provide administrative support to businesses or individuals remotely. Their responsibilities can include managing emails, scheduling appointments, handling data entry, organizing files, and performing other clerical tasks using digital tools. Virtual Admins allow companies to delegate routine tasks, improve productivity, and reduce overhead costs, as they typically work from home or remote locations. They often have strong organizational, communication, and technical skills. Many Virtual Admins work as freelancers or through specialized agencies.

Job description

EPS Corporation is Looking for a System Administrator/Eningeer will support the MACC-TTE virtual and physical environments by performing systems integration, administration, engineering, maintenance, monitoring, and infrastructure support activities. The selected candidate will configure, deploy, operate, secure, and maintain enterprise-level network and systems infrastructure across cloud, virtualized, and physical environments. This role requires a highly skilled technical professional with experience supporting complex enterprise architectures, cybersecurity initiatives, and emerging technologies.

This position is dependent upon the award of the Proposed ContractPerform systems integration, system management, configuration, operation, testing, troubleshooting, and reset of MACC-TTE virtual and physical environments. Configure, deploy, and maintain virtual and physical servers, workstations, and processor-controlled devices within the MACC-TTE environment. Operate, maintain, and enhance infrastructure supporting virtualized and physical systems to ensure a stable and cohesive enterprise environment.

Support and assist with Information Assurance (IA) and cybersecurity compliance requirements. Design, configure, and maintain enterprise computer networks including routing, switching, firewalls, DNS, Active Directory, VPNs, VLANs, and SAN environments. Manage and administer Windows Enterprise and Linux server operating systems.

Engineer and maintain virtualization platforms including VMware, KVM, and Xen hypervisors. Support cloud, physical, and virtual network architectures and infrastructure monitoring solutions. Implement and maintain automation, orchestration, provisioning, imaging, and configuration management solutions.

Utilize open-source technologies and applications including Ansible, Python, and other automation and management tools. Monitor system performance, troubleshoot infrastructure issues, and implement corrective actions to ensure operational readiness. Identify network vulnerabilities, analyze attack vectors, and implement mitigation strategies to maintain secure operations.

Support integration and administration of specialized technologies including camera systems, ICS/SCADA systems, Internet of Things (IoT) devices, and RF systems. Develop and maintain technical documentation, system configurations, operational procedures, and architecture diagrams. Collaborate with engineering, cybersecurity, and operational teams to support mission requirements and system modernization efforts.

Required Qualifications Education Bachelor's Degree in Network Engineering, Cybersecurity, Information Management, or a related discipline. Relevant experience may be substituted in lieu of degree requirements. Experience Minimum seven (7) years of experience as a Cyber Subject Matter Expert (SME), Cyber Architect, Systems Administrator, Systems Engineer, or in a similar technical role.

Demonstrated experience designing, configuring, and managing enterprise computer networks and systems infrastructure. Experience with virtualization technologies, cloud infrastructure, and hybrid enterprise environments. Experience with automation, orchestration, provisioning, imaging, and configuration management tools.

Experience working with open-source technologies and scripting/automation tools such as Ansible and Python. Experience supporting Windows and Linux enterprise operating systems. Knowledge of cybersecurity principles, network vulnerabilities, attack vectors, and mitigation techniques.

Experience supporting ICS/SCADA, IoT, RF devices, and related technologies preferred. Certifications Must meet DoDM 8140.03 IAT II requirements. Security Clearance Active Top Secret (TS) clearance with Sensitive Compartmented Information (SCI) eligibility or access required

Desired Skills Strong analytical, troubleshooting, and problem-solving skills. Ability to manage multiple technical priorities in a fast-paced environment. Excellent verbal and written communication skills.

Ability to work independently and collaboratively within a technical team environment.
